Output d948cdf025b68eb90b094b329e293b1eacb890af7b0dffed18dba5568279ee7d:23

value
862623
script pubkey
OP_0 OP_PUSHBYTES_20 8d59f962c8729554b31ad63c713be9feeabd979a
address
bc1q34vljckgw224fvc66c78zwlflm4tm9u6jaw28p
transaction
d948cdf025b68eb90b094b329e293b1eacb890af7b0dffed18dba5568279ee7d
confirmations
174175
spent
true